This book defines energy and examines how energy from the sun provides us with heat.

If your kid is just starting to read chapter books or even picture books, this is a solid pick. Fowler breaks down the big idea of "what is energy?" into simple, easy-to-grasp pieces, and the sun is the perfect example to hook young readers. The whole thing is only 424 words, so it moves fast and won't overwhelm kids who get antsy with longer books. Parents will like that it sneaks in real science without feeling like a textbook, and the photos and illustrations keep things visually interesting. It's great for kids who love "how things work" questions or anyone doing a solar system unit at school.
